Over the 12 years from 2014 to 2025, Clark County recorded 392 distinct power outage events, averaging 3.2 hours per event.

The single worst outage on record in Clark County started November 12, 2025, lasting less than 1 hour and leaving up to 11,660 customers without power (61% of the county) at its peak.

July has historically been the worst month for outages in Clark County, with 48 events recorded during that month across the dataset.

Based on this history, Clark County earns a Reliability Grade of C, placing it in the 58th percentile nationally for grid reliability (higher percentile = more reliable).
